Responsibilities
Assist dentists during a variety of dental procedures including restorative, endodontic, prosthodontic, and pediatric treatments with precision and efficiency.
Prepare treatment rooms by sterilizing instruments, setting up necessary supplies, and ensuring all equipment is functioning correctly following infection control protocols.
Take and develop dental X-rays using advanced imaging technology such as 3D scanners, ensuring patient safety and comfort while adhering to HIPAA regulations for medical documentation and records.
Manage patient flow by greeting patients, updating medical histories, taking vital signs, and explaining procedures clearly to foster a positive experience.
Maintain accurate medical and dental records using EMR (Electronic Medical Records) systems like Eaglesoft, ensuring compliance with HIPAA standards.
Support administrative duties including scheduling appointments, answering phone calls as a dental receptionist, and managing patient communications efficiently.
Demonstrate proficiency in dental terminology, aseptic techniques, anatomy knowledge, and infection control practices to uphold the highest standards of safety and quality care.
